Bag om The Birds of Middlesex

""The Birds of Middlesex: A Contribution to the Natural History of the County"" is a comprehensive guide to the bird species found in Middlesex, England, written by James Edmund Harting and originally published in 1866. The book provides detailed descriptions of each bird species, including their physical characteristics, habitat, behavior, and distribution within the county. The author also includes information on the history of ornithology in Middlesex, as well as observations and anecdotes from his own experiences studying the local bird population.
